Output 3a95412666623eb84ebd7af5182ee620b1d05c9c29c096ebe0a97f06ee54f9db:2
- value
- 149280680
- script pubkey
- OP_0 OP_PUSHBYTES_32 e13d733d9c9b5a598b1f457383d7fa38a0103af9135cd7d564c65942edf0a76f
- address
- bc1quy7hx0vundd9nzclg4ec84l68zspqwhezdwd04tycev59m0s5ahsnt9amt
- transaction
- 3a95412666623eb84ebd7af5182ee620b1d05c9c29c096ebe0a97f06ee54f9db
- confirmations
- 195831
- spent
- true